About Rosedale Park
This award-winning family-run site on the Welsh-Shropshire border has been welcoming guests since 1994, and its near-perfect rating speaks volumes. All pitches—both hardstanding and grass—are level, spacious and come with electric hook-up, making set-up straightforward for caravans and motorhomes alike. The rural location strikes a lovely balance: peaceful enough to feel properly away from it all, yet an hourly bus service stops right at the entrance, whisking you to Whitchurch or Wrexham if you'd rather leave your outfit on site.
It's an ideal base for exploring the meres around Ellesmere and the dramatic scenery of the Vale of Llangollen. The adults-only policy keeps things tranquil, though well-behaved dogs are welcome. With only a small number of pitches, the atmosphere remains relaxed and personal—just what you'd hope for from a long-established family operation.

What visitors say
Nice location, well maintained lawns and hedges. Nice clean facilities though a bit short on loo roll. Friendly owners and a good price. Several footpaths in the area but a little clearing needed so take a nettle stick. The owner later told me there were more loo rolls in dispensers I'd overlooked :)

Just spent a couple of days at Rosedale caravan park, penley nr wrexham. The site is immaculate and a credit to Caroline who is on top of her game. As a motorhomer, we tend to use public transport to see local areas and there's a small bus that passes the entrance but not very often, and Caroline was very helpful with that. When next in the area this will be a definite go to place.
